Sainsbury's

Founded in 1869 by John James Sainsbury and his wife in Drury Lane, London, Sainsbury's has been a recognizable retailer for more than 100 years. The company currently operates more than 1,400 stores in the UK and also provides online shopping options. In the 1990s, Sainsbury's began focusing on its own-brand products. This included the introduction of an assortment of premium own-brand food items that were comparable to the national brands, but were priced lower. The new way of doing business by the company resulted in greater satisfaction with prices and more loyal customers.

The company also launched small stores, dubbed Country Towns, which allowed customers to shop for their daily requirements without needing to travel to larger out-of-town shops. This expansion was a crucial step in creating the brand as a top retailer of groceries.

Founded in 1899, the business was initially a small egg and butter stall at Rawson Market in Bradford. The founder's son, Ken, took over the business in 1952 and guided it to an impressive float on London Stock Exchange in 1967. The company now has over 300 stores and provides a wide range of services, including a popular pharmacy, cafes and dry cleaners.
